33. Fly Fishing
There is nothing quite like fly fishing in the Colorado Rockies. Smith Fork Ranch
is uniquely blessed with three miles of its own river ….five stocked trout
ponds….a mountain stream that is one of only two natural habitats in the state for
the rare A-strain Colorado Cutthroat trout. And on top of that, SFR sits closer to
more Gold Medal fishing water than any other 5 star destination in Colorado.

37. For the ultimate in
fly-fishing, a day on
“the Gunny” is not
to be missed. The
Gunnison River is a
world-renowned,
gold medal trout
fishery. A float
through the steep
walled Gunnison
Gorge is
recognized
as one of the top fly
fishing trips in the
lower 48.
This National Conservation Area lies just downstream of the Black Canyon of the
Gunnison National Park and features spectacular scenery, interesting geology,
sightings of varied wildlife, and most importantly excellent fly fishing for rainbow and
brown trout. Trophy rainbows measuring 20”+ are the prize of the “Gunny”. The
Gunnison River holds more fish per mile than any other river in the state. The latest
data showed 8,779 fish per mile.
